**Runbook: Restarting the Pedalshift rebalancer**

If Pedalshift stops emitting station-transfer plans, first drain the queue worker, then restart the planner pod. Plans older than 20 minutes are discarded automatically, so no manual cleanup is needed. Confirm the dock-occupancy feed is fresh before re-enabling. Record the running build token shown here for the handoff log.

build token for kagaf-hahof: htk14_9d3d4d26d7d8de

# SQL lint settings for the Bramblewick repo.
#
# These rules enforce our house style: uppercase keywords, explicit
# column lists (no SELECT *), and mandatory WHERE clauses on deletes.
# New team members: do not disable rules locally; add a suppression
# comment in the offending file instead so reviewers can see it.
# The linter validates schema references against the live catalog,
# so it needs read access at lint time.
# It reaches the catalog using the connection string below.

warehouse DSN: mssql://rusdor_svc:0FSWCn9@db-951a.paliqforge.local:5432/ulawyn

Ticket #2281 — Vellum Reports: unstable sort order in grouped exports. When users sort by a column with duplicate values, row order within ties changes between runs because the builder uses an unstable quicksort over paged results. Customers on Pelorin's compliance team flagged this as a blocker since exports must be reproducible for audits. Fix switches to a stable merge pass keyed on row id. No schema or API changes. Requesting inclusion in the next patch train; the candidate build token follows below.

pipeline stamp: htk31_cf382a21f378a9173b24262eddce4d5

### Runbook: ReceiptRelay mailer stuck

Symptoms: donation receipts queueing, no sends, queue depth alert fires.

First: check the SMTP relay health endpoint. If healthy, the mailer worker is probably wedged on a malformed template — restart the worker pool, not the whole service. If unhealthy, fail over to the secondary relay and page the infra rotation. Do not replay the dead-letter queue until dedupe is confirmed on, or donors get duplicate receipts. Verify the service is running with the following configuration values.

config for kajeg-bafop:
[julael]
host = julael.plorvadata.corp
user = julael_svc
database = julael_prod